Nigeria’s top table tennis player, Aruna Quadri, has qualified for the World Table Tennis finals billed for Doha, Qatar, PUNCH Sports Extra reports. He remains the only African player to have featured in the WTT Finals having competed at the maiden edition in Singapore as well as the 2022 edition in China. Quadri also holds the record of the best finish at the tournament by an African. At the 2022 edition in China, he exited in the first round after losing 3-1 to world number eight Chinese Taipei’s Lin Yun-Ju. Other players billed to feature at the tourney includes Zhendong (China), Wang Chuqin (China), Ma Long (China), Hugo Calderano (Brazil), Liang Jingkun (China), Lin Yun-Yu (Chinese Taipei), Felix Lebrun (France), Lin Gaoyuan (China), Jang Woojin (South Korea), Lin Shidong (China), Tomokazu Harimoto (Japan), Dimitrij Ovtcharov (Germany), Dang Qiu (Germany) and Darko Jorgic (Slovenia).

Sustainable industrialization generally is referred to the process of transforming traditional industries into environmentally conscious and socially responsible entities while promoting economic growth. It aims to minimize negative environmental impacts, resource depletion, and social inequalities associated with industrial activities. Some Strategies for Implementing Sustainable Industrialization includes:Green Technology Adoption:Promoting the use of clean technologies, such as renewable energy sources and energy-efficient machinery, can significantly reduce environmental impacts. Stakeholder Engagement:Engaging stakeholders, including local communities, NGOs, and industry representatives, is crucial for sustainable industrialization. Finally, Public administrators should work hand in hand with the government to ensure facilitation of sustainable industrialization through policy formulation, regulation, and enforcement.

China’s declining growth is set to affect Nigeria’s economic fortune, the International Monetary Fund has disclosed. IMF noted that because China has forged deep economic ties with countries in sub-Saharan Africa over the past 20 years, its recent declining growth may affect growth in Nigeria by 0.5 percentage points on average. It, however, noted that China’s recovery from the pandemic is now set to ripple across Africa. A one percentage point decline in China’s growth rate could reduce average growth in the region by about 0.25 percentage points within a year, according to the latest Regional Economic Outlook. In a recent development, the National Industrial Court (NIC) has intervened in the brewing conflict between the Nigerian Labour Congress (NLC), the Trade Union Congress (TUC), and their affiliates, and the Imo State Government. The court issued a restraining order against the planned nationwide strike scheduled to commence on November 14, which was initially prompted by the assault on the NLC National President, Joe Ajaero, in Imo State. The application sought to prevent the strike in order to avert potential hardships on law-abiding citizens and their businesses. Justice Kanyip instructed that the restraining order be prominently displayed on the wall of the Labour House, the last known address of the NLC and TUC, to communicate the court’s decision. Justice Anuwe, the Court President, is expected to issue a hearing notice to the involved parties at an appropriate time.

President Joe Biden and Chinese President Xi Jinping will meet Wednesday in California for talks on trade, Taiwan and managing fraught US-Chinese relations in the first engagement between the leaders of the world’s two biggest economies in nearly a year, Biden administration officials said. The White House has said for weeks that it anticipated Biden and Xi would meet on the sidelines of the Asia-Pacific Economic Cooperation summit in San Francisco, but negotiations went down to the eve of the gathering, which kicks off Saturday. Biden and Xi last met nearly a year ago on the sidelines of the Group of 20 summit in Bali, Indonesia. In the nearly three-hour meeting, Biden objected directly to China’s “coercive and increasingly aggressive actions” toward Taiwan and discussed Russia’s invasion of Ukraine and other issues. The officials also noted that Biden is determined to restore military-to-military communications that Beijing largely withdrew from after then-House Speaker Nancy Pelosi’s visit to Taiwan in August 2022.

By Glazyl Y. MasculinoBACOLOD City – People flocked to the second opening of the “Bigasan ng Bayan” stall at the Food Terminal Market of Negros Occidental (FTMON) here last Tuesday. Governor Eugenio Jose Lacson has assured his constituents that this program will be continued and that other groups will be tapped. The “Bigasan ng Bayan” was launched last month, allowing a maximum of five kilos per person to ensure that everyone can avail of it. The FIACN-BRIS would sell 10 percent of their total production to the public at P25 per kilo whenever supply is available. According to FIACN-BRIS President Pedro Limpangog, 44 irrigators associations are part of this collaboration.
